Includes bibliographical references and index.
1: Prologue;
2: Basic Formulas for Electron Transport;
3: Green's Function Techniques for Electron Transport;
4: Numerical Methods Based on Density Functional Theory;
5: Atomistic Nanosystems;
6: Artificial Nanosystems;
7: Epilogue;
References;
Index.
As the electric devices become smaller and smaller at nanometer size, transport simulations based on the quantum mechanics become more and more important. This book provides various quantum transport simulation methods and shows applications for transport properties of nanometer-scale systems.
